Matt Cardona Breaks Silence On WWE Losing Streak

Matt Cardona is staying determined despite his ongoing losing streak on SmackDown and growing fan criticism over the way WWE has booked his return. Following his previous WWE release, Cardona completely reinvented himself on the independent wrestling scene, becoming one of the biggest names outside the company. His success away from WWE sparked heavy fan support for a comeback. That eventually led to appearances in NXT before Cardona officially signed a new WWE contract earlier this year. Given how much his profile had grown during his time away, expectations for his return were incredibly high. Although Cardona received a strong reaction from fans when he came back, that momentum has not translated into victories on television. Rather than being placed in a major storyline, he has largely been used in supporting roles. After suffering another defeat on the May 8, 2026 episode of SmackDown, Cardona took to Twitter with a passionate message aimed at critics questioning his future in WWE. He wrote, “It took me almost 6 years to get back to @WWE… You think losing some matches is going to stop me? LOL. It’s not over until I quit…and that’s never going to happen. I’M NOT FINISHED.” Cardona picked up another loss on last week’s episode of SmackDown when he was defeated by Ricky Saints in singles action. Despite putting together a competitive performance and nearly securing the win, Saints ultimately finished him off with the Roshambo. The defeat continued a difficult stretch for the former Zack Ryder. Since defeating Kit Wilson in his return match back in January, Matt Cardona has gone 0-6, with most of those losses coming against rising stars and established names on the SmackDown roster.
